Technologist David Auerbach weighs in on the debate surrounding the rapid development of artificial intelligence and its impact on the future of humanity.

Arriaga seemingly affirmed Blackman's comments, saying he"realized, like [the usage of this app and relationship with Phaedra] actually is a very positive thing, until it wasn't." explicitly developed to provide virtual companionship for those feeling isolated or lonely. These chatbots can speak with users and offer advice based on online knowledge while also recalling past conversations to contextualize the individual's feelings.

"In mental health, AI can play a role in early detection and treatment of depression, but it is essential to ensure that human empathy and understanding remain central to the process. In both instances, human connection is still key," he toldLife and business coach Angie Wisdom warned that the long-term effects of an increased relationship between humans and AI pose a threat to human"authenticity.

Auerbach agreed that the technology is"very, very powerful," but explained that when it comes to devaluing human relationships, society is"already there."that happens today already, even without AI being present, has been stripped down to some of its most superficial and inhuman aspects that just because there's a human on the other end doesn't mean that you're dealing with the best part of humanity," he said.
